Java Netbeans Memasukkan Nilai dan Menghitung Rata-rata ke Tabel
Contoh cara membuat program java menggunakan netbeans.
Program insert nilai, nama ke tabel dan menghitung rata-ratanya.
membuat program sederhana netbean java
Jika kolom isian nama, nilai matematika, nilai Bahasa Indonesia, nilai IPA diisikan lalu tombol simpan di klik maka data yang diisikan tadi akan ditampilkan pada tabel dengan nomor urut. Kemudian jika data pada tabel dipilih salah satu dan tombol hapus di klik maka data yang terpilih akan terhapus.
No urut tampil secera otomatis dan untuk menghitung rata-rata ketiga nilai yang dimasukkan.
Buatlah bentuk GUInya (seperti gambar diatas) menggunakan jFrame yang terdiri dari beberapa komponen: jTextFieldNama(untuk Nama) jTextFieldMtk (untuk Nilai Matematika), jTextFieldBIndo (untuk Nilai Bahasa Indonesia), jTextFieldIPA (untuk Nilai IPA), jButtonsIMPAN (untuk tombol Simpan), jButtonhAPUS (untuk tombol Hapus), dan jTableNilai
Ketikan Script code dibawah ini untuk tombol Action Perfomed Simpan (Klik kanan tombol simpan lalu Action>>Action Performed):
private void jButtonSimpanActionPerformed(java.awt.event.ActionEvent evt) {
DefaultTableModel tableModel = (DefaultTableModel) jTableNilai.getModel();
String [] dataNilai = new String[6];
double jml = Float.valueOf(jTextFieldMtk.getText())
+Float.valueOf(jTextFieldBIndo.getText())
+Float.valueOf(jTextFieldIPA.getText());
dataNilai[0]=String.valueOf(1 + jTableNilai.getRowCount());
dataNilai[1]=jTextFieldNama.getText();
dataNilai[2]=jTextFieldMtk.getText();
dataNilai[3]=jTextFieldBIndo.getText();
dataNilai[4]=jTextFieldIPA.getText();
dataNilai[5]=String.valueOf(jml/3);
tableModel.addRow(dataNilai);// TODO add your handling code here:
}
Ketikan Script code dibawah ini untuk tombol Action Perfomed Hapus (Klik kanan tombol Hapus lalu Action>>Action Performed):
private void jButtonHapusActionPerformed(java.awt.event.ActionEvent evt) {
DefaultTableModel tableModel = (DefaultTableModel)jTableNilai.getModel();
tableModel.removeRow(jTableNilai.getSelectedRow());// TODO add your handling code here:
}
coba di run hasilnya:
Program insert nilai, nama ke tabel dan menghitung rata-ratanya.
membuat program sederhana netbean java
Jika kolom isian nama, nilai matematika, nilai Bahasa Indonesia, nilai IPA diisikan lalu tombol simpan di klik maka data yang diisikan tadi akan ditampilkan pada tabel dengan nomor urut. Kemudian jika data pada tabel dipilih salah satu dan tombol hapus di klik maka data yang terpilih akan terhapus.
No urut tampil secera otomatis dan untuk menghitung rata-rata ketiga nilai yang dimasukkan.
Buatlah bentuk GUInya (seperti gambar diatas) menggunakan jFrame yang terdiri dari beberapa komponen: jTextFieldNama(untuk Nama) jTextFieldMtk (untuk Nilai Matematika), jTextFieldBIndo (untuk Nilai Bahasa Indonesia), jTextFieldIPA (untuk Nilai IPA), jButtonsIMPAN (untuk tombol Simpan), jButtonhAPUS (untuk tombol Hapus), dan jTableNilai
Ketikan Script code dibawah ini untuk tombol Action Perfomed Simpan (Klik kanan tombol simpan lalu Action>>Action Performed):
private void jButtonSimpanActionPerformed(java.awt.event.ActionEvent evt) {
DefaultTableModel tableModel = (DefaultTableModel) jTableNilai.getModel();
String [] dataNilai = new String[6];
double jml = Float.valueOf(jTextFieldMtk.getText())
+Float.valueOf(jTextFieldBIndo.getText())
+Float.valueOf(jTextFieldIPA.getText());
dataNilai[0]=String.valueOf(1 + jTableNilai.getRowCount());
dataNilai[1]=jTextFieldNama.getText();
dataNilai[2]=jTextFieldMtk.getText();
dataNilai[3]=jTextFieldBIndo.getText();
dataNilai[4]=jTextFieldIPA.getText();
dataNilai[5]=String.valueOf(jml/3);
tableModel.addRow(dataNilai);// TODO add your handling code here:
}
Ketikan Script code dibawah ini untuk tombol Action Perfomed Hapus (Klik kanan tombol Hapus lalu Action>>Action Performed):
private void jButtonHapusActionPerformed(java.awt.event.ActionEvent evt) {
DefaultTableModel tableModel = (DefaultTableModel)jTableNilai.getModel();
tableModel.removeRow(jTableNilai.getSelectedRow());// TODO add your handling code here:
}
coba di run hasilnya:
Terima kasih, Gan..
ReplyDeleteArtikelnya sangat membantu (y)..
bingung mz browwwww
ReplyDeletekunjungi back yo mz bro http://chameleoncute.blogspot.co.id/2017/10/membuat-kalkulator-menggunakan-java-gui.html